Caution: Never shake, drop or hit cartridges against the palm of your hand or any
other hard surface. Shaking the print cartridge does not mix ink and hitting
cartridges against a hard surface does not clear the nozzles. These actions hurt
print quality because they allow bubbles to form near the ink firing chambers. These
bubbles prevent the nozzles from firing, causing white streaks in print image.

Replacing the Metering Segments (Sheet Separators)

Metering Segments (sheet separators) ensure separation of pieces as they are fed. They wear and must
be replaced periodically. If you experience double sheet feeding and cannot adjust the separators to
prevent it, replace them.
You can order sheet separators at pitneybowes.com, supply item number 90-103-09s.
1. Turn off and unplug the printer.
2. Release the separator locking lever and move the media side guides to maximum opened position.
3. Lower the separators so that they touch the feed roller.
